PDFix SDK: PDFix SDK is a highly efficient tool for converting PDFs to responsive HTML and extracting data. It also transforms PDF forms to HTML forms and converts PDFs to Word documents accurately.

Infigo: Infigo offers fully branded web-to-print e-commerce storefronts. Powerful personalisation and efficient print workflows are provided for seamless print production.

PDFix Make Accessible Is Now Live in Enfocus Switch

PDFix has launched "Make Accessible," a free app integrated into Enfocus Switch, automating PDF accessibility remediation. It utilizes the PDFix SDK to process PDFs, ensuring compliance with accessibility standards like the EU's European Accessibility Act and the US ADA Title II rule. The app streamlines tagging and structure fixes, requiring a PDFix SDK license for operation.

Infigo Appoints printIQ as Official Reseller for Australia and New Zealand

Infigo has appointed printIQ as its official reseller for Australia and New Zealand, effective January 1, 2026. This partnership formalizes a collaboration that began in 2019, allowing printIQ to provide local expertise and support for Infigo's web-to-print solutions. The integration offers automated workflows, real-time inventory visibility, and advanced quoting capabilities, enhancing print businesses' efficiency in the region.
